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Excel
Excel Forum d'entraide sur Excel. Vos questions sur les fonctions, formules, manipulations, et tout sujet qui ne trouve pas sa place dans un sous-forum.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 28/06/2011, 22h26   #1
Invité de passage
 
Inscription : août 2010
Messages : 2
Détails du profil
Informations forums :
Inscription : août 2010
Messages : 2
Points : 0
Points : 0
Par défaut RechercheV / Index-Equiv Multiple.

Bonsoir,

J'ai un petit soucis au niveau d'une recherchev (ou index-equiv, peut m'importe la solution...).

Pour plus de clarté je vous joins un fichier d'exemple : http://up.sur-la-toile.com/iOLq

J'ai en fait, dans la colonne B certaines références, numéro dans la colonne A.
Et de la même façon, dans la colonne I et H.
A la base, je n'avais pas le soucis que j'ai actuellement, c'est à dire que mes références étaient uniques des deux cotés, donc, une simple recherchev suffisait à répondre à mes attentes.
Or il s'avère que le problème se complique, et que des références se dédoublent (voulu par mon métier). En sachant que si la référence "azerty" dans la colonne B est présente 3 fois, elle sera également (ou à priori ?) présente 3 fois également dans la colonne I.

Je souhaite dans la colonne C récupérer le numéro de la colonne H qui fasse coincider 2 références identiques de la colonne B et I.

Dans le fichier, par exemple, en B24, c'est la 3eme occurence de titi, je veux donc aller chercher la ligne correspondante à la 3eme occurence de titi dans la colonne I (ici, on devrait donc récupérer 17).

Je ne sais pas si je suis très clair... Mais en fait, chaque référence de la colonne de gauche, doit aller matcher avec une référence de la colonne de droite, et me donner son numéro correspondant...
J'ai réussi à me débrouiller avec des imbrications de SI / INDEX / EQUIV... pour l'apparition de 2 occurences, voir 3 si je pousse un peu, mais en pratique, cette référence peut se répéter 10... 15... 20 fois ! Et je n'ai guère envie d'avoir une formule de 20 lignes...
Je PENSE que cela est faisable plus simplement que ce que j'ai fais actuellement, notamment, via des formules matricielles, mais j'avoue ne pas vraiment maîtriser ce genre de formule...

Si quelqu'un à au moins une idée pour me dépanner, ce serait très gentil. (Si possible de faire un exemple dans le fichier joint ?)

J'ai quelques contraintes pour réaliser ceci... Le fichier doit tourner sous excel 2003, et sans macro... (Avec macro, le problème serait bien plus simple...).
Edit : Et évidemment, le triage n'est pas une option possible. Les occurrences doivent rester dans l'ordre qu'elles sont.

Merci d'avance.

Cordialement,
Oni.
Onihylis est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/06/2011, 10h36   #2
Membre éprouvé
 
Homme Franck PRESSE
Inscription : août 2010
Messages : 202
Détails du profil
Informations personnelles :
Nom : Homme Franck PRESSE
Âge : 38
Localisation : France, Nord (Nord Pas de Calais)

Informations forums :
Inscription : août 2010
Messages : 202
Points : 444
Points : 444
Bonjour,
Il vous faut, à mon avis, passer par une colonne intermédiaire de calcul. Dans l'exemple ci-joint la colonne G (commentaires) sert de champ de recherche pour la fonction Equiv. Cette colonne peux être masquée. Vous copiez la formule en AA (par exemple) et vous masquez cette colonne...
Le résultat en colonne E.
Votre exemple
__________________
Cordialement,
Franck P.


Ps : n'oubliez pas de placer vos posts comme "résolus" () si tel est le cas...
pijaku est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/06/2011, 22h00   #3
Invité de passage
 
Inscription : août 2010
Messages : 2
Détails du profil
Informations forums :
Inscription : août 2010
Messages : 2
Points : 0
Points : 0
Merci beaucoup, je regarde en détail en soirée !
Onihylis est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 02h27.


 
 
 
 
Partenaires

Hébergement Web